Recently spotted multiple times
last 30 minDetection: same DX call on the same band within ±1 kHz and five minutes. Repeats from the same spotter count as spotter duplicates; near-identical copies within ten seconds count as transport duplicates. Origin-node statistics are separate and do not automatically represent the direct ingress peer.
⇄ Direct Peer Traffic & Contribution
Shows the real ingress of spot messages through DA6IT-2’s direct peers. Overlap is intentional cluster redundancy, not an error rate; First Seen shows which direct path delivered a logical spot first.

Received counts the spot messages that actually arrived. First Seen, Exclusive and Overlap refer to logical spot groups. High overlap is normal and desirable in a well-connected DX Cluster.
